Merge "Fix dupicate preference in personal dict"

This commit is contained in:
Tarandeep Singh
2019-03-27 18:15:04 +00:00
committed by Android (Google) Code Review

View File

@@ -174,7 +174,10 @@ public class UserDictionaryListPreferenceController extends BasePreferenceContro
mScreen.addPreference(createUserDictionaryPreference(null)); mScreen.addPreference(createUserDictionaryPreference(null));
} else { } else {
for (String locale : localeSet) { for (String locale : localeSet) {
mScreen.addPreference(createUserDictionaryPreference(locale)); final Preference pref = createUserDictionaryPreference(locale);
if (mScreen.findPreference(pref.getKey()) == null) {
mScreen.addPreference(pref);
}
} }
} }
} }